BPA STUDENTS ON TO NATIONALS!

HARLAN -- Students from Harlan Community High School will be attending the Business Professionals of America (BPA) 2022 National Leadership Conference, in Dallas, TX, May 4-8.    HCHS chapter members will join nearly 6,000 conference delegates from across the nation to compete in national level business skills competitions and attend leadership development, workshops, general sessions, and national officer candidate campaigns and elections.

Wendt begins duties as Shelby County Extension Director

    HARLAN -- There is a new and friendly face in the Shelby County Extension office. Harlan native Larry Wendt, Jr. began his work as the Shelby County Director on February 7, 2022. As County Director Wendt will have the responsibility of coordinating Shelby County Extension programs delivered by Iowa State University Extension and Outreach.
